PBS Reno Hires Education Manager

 

Tammy Brocker: Education Manager of PBS Reno

RENO, NV (APR 28, 2023)PBS Reno has hired Tammy Brocker for the role of Education Manager. Brocker started Wednesday, April 19, 2023.

Brocker joins the expanding Education Services arm of PBS Reno that deploys a team of 40+ accredited facilitators to classrooms in seven counties in northern Nevada. She is a certified special education teacher with nine years of experience in the classroom in Washoe County School District. She holds a master’s degree in Special Education from the University of Nevada and a bachelor’s degree in Journalism and Mass Communication from the University of New Mexico, Albuquerque.

“I have always wanted to work at PBS Reno beyond my role as a facilitator,” said Brocker. “I love kids and education is my passion. In my new role as Education Manager, I now have the pleasure of elevating our Curiosity Classroom Workshops to reach even more local students. I’m so happy to get to experience the joys of PBS Reno full time!”

As Education Manager, Brocker will communicate with PBS Reno’s 40+ facilitators who deliver more than 4,295 Curiosity Classroom Workshops annually to classrooms in Washoe County, Carson City, Douglas County, Lyon County, Humboldt County, Elko County, and White Pine County. Brocker will oversee the materials and supplies utilized by PBS Reno Education Services and will ensure each facilitator meets the needs of local students. 

“We are so pleased to have Tammy joining the PBS Reno Education Services team,” said Nancy Maldonado, PBS Reno Vice President of Education. “Tammy has been an enthusiastic facilitator with our Curiosity Classroom STEM workshop program for the 2022-23 school year, and her teaching experience in Washoe County School District is exceptional. She is a perfect fit for the Education department at PBS Reno and we are grateful for her support!”

 

About PBS Reno

As of February 2023, PBS Reno Channel 5.1 is watched weekly by more than 98,377 people in approximately 67,400 households in northern and central Nevada and northeastern California, with viewership on multicast channels Reno Create 5.2 and PBS KIDS Reno 5.3. PBS Reno channels are also available on cable, satellite services, and via livestream on YouTube TV. PBS Reno provides PBS national programming and award-earning, locally-produced content, with many local segments posted weekly to PBS Reno’s YouTube Channel. PBSReno.org provides engaging interactive content, including the video portal at watch.PBSReno.org that streams all locally-produced content and most PBS national content. PBS Reno serves students, teachers, parents and caregivers through immersive educational services including Curiosity Classroom Workshops that bring classroom lessons to life with standards-based lessons and activities. Through the support of local corporations and foundations, as well as thousands of individual members, PBS Reno has been delivering public television and educational services to the communities it serves since 1983.
